The conference sessions will commence on Thursday, 4 July and will run through to lunch time on Saturday 6 July. The conference sessions will be convened in the Case Study Room at The University Club of Western Australia, on the edge of the beautiful Swan River, Western Australia.
The HETSA conference reception will be held in the Kingswood room at Trinity College Wednesday 3rd July from 7.30pm to 9pm.
All members of HETSA, especially the younger members of our Society, are encouraged to present their research at this conference. But the conference is not limited HETSA members. Contributors to the History of Economic Thought from other HET Societies around the world are also most welcome to register and participate at this conference.
